overseas work experience while living in china

I worked more than 3 years as a translator in Poland but after working 1 year there, as my girlfriend moved to china, I stayed on a tourist L visa with her in china while still being employed in my home country as I was able to do my job off-site. After a year in China I came back and continued my work for more than a year. Now I am offered a job in China but wonder if my work experience is valid as 1 year of that is when I actually lived in China. Am I eligible for working Z in China?

Hi, you can apply for Chinese work Z type of course if you have official invitation letter and work permit. So, contact the company for those documents first.
